How much do part time pneumatic tanker driver j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time pneumatic tanker driver in the United States is $26.21,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$24.04 and $27.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

We are currently seeking a Part-Time CDL Truck Driver to join our team. This position is ideal for individuals looking for a consistent schedule while maintaining work-life balance.


Position Overview

This role requires availability for three days per week. Typical workdays are approximately 12-14 hours, depending on project needs and weather conditions. Drivers will safely haul asphalt, aggregate, and other construction materials to and from project sites.


Essential Duties & Responsibilities

  • Valid Commercial Driver's License, Class A or Class B
  • Tanker and hazardous material endorsements preferred
  • Acceptable motor vehicle record
  • Current DOT Medical card
  • Acceptable roadside inspection record
  • Must be able to meet all Federal Motor Carrier Regulation standards
  • Strong communication skills and the ability to work as part of a team
  • Physical strength and endurance to perform all principal duties and responsibilities
